Keto Breve

One of our favorite drinks to purchase from our local coffee shop is a breve! However, did you know that it is super easy to make at home? All you need is a milk frother which is worth the investment if you love a good latte. It is low-carb and Keto-friendly, which is perfect around the holidays! The additional fat in the latte is wonderful when you don’t mind a couple extra calories. The heavy cream in the latte is very low in net carbs. It is also a blank canvas for a variety of flavors, especially with so many sugar-free syrup options nowadays!

Can you add sweetener?

Yes! Feel free to add any kind of sugar-free syrup like vanilla or caramel to this. However, you should definitely try this recipe without any additional sweetener (because it is so good!).

Why does this recipe use cream and not milk?

Heavy cream is lower in net carbs than whole milk, so you can safely add healthy fats to your drink.

How should you brew the coffee?

You should brew the coffee using a traditional coffee maker (but add extra grounds to make the coffee strong), a French press, or an espresso machine.

How can you serve this beverage?

Ingredients

  • Coffee

    Coffee

    24 fluid ounce

  • Heavy Cream by 365

    Heavy Cream by 365

    ¾ cup

Recipe Steps

steps 3

9 min

  • Step 1

    Brew a nice strong cup of coffee either with an espresso maker, French press, or traditional coffee maker. If using a conventional coffee maker, add an extra tablespoon or more grounds to make it extra strong. Place your coffee mug in your coffee maker's slot.
    Step 1
  • Step 2

    Add the heavy cream into a milk frother. Use the milk frother according to package directions. This should include pressing the hot froth setting to heat the cream and foam it simultaneously.
    Step 2
  • Step 3

    Add ¼ of the frothed cream mixture (or about 3 tbsp non-frothed cream)to the coffee. garnish the top with a few coffee granules. Serve immediately!
